
ESL One Birmingham 2018 Playoffs Analysis and Predictions
The Playoffs stage of ESL One Birmingham 2018 is starting today and only 6 of the initial 12 teams are left in the tournament. The stakes are high for at least 2 of these teams (Fnatic and OpTic Gaming), who have a real chance of climbing into the top 8 within the Dota Pro Circuit rankings. All they need to do is reach the Grand Final and their direct invite to The International is almost assured.
The Playoffs stage of ESL One Birmingham 2018 is scheduled to take place between May 25th – 27th and the 6 matches it features will no doubt offer a great show.

paiN Gaming vs. Mineski
The very presence of paiN Gaming in the Playoffs of ESL One Birmingham 2018 is a miracle. PaiN Gaming entered this tournament as a complete outsider who had 0 points in the Dota Pro Circuit rankings. And it had to get a top 2 finish in a group with 3 theoretically stronger opponents: Team Liquid, Vici Gaming and OG. Shockingly enough, the group was won by OG and paiN Gaming finished 2nd after 2 victories against the TI 7 champions, Team Liquid.
Mineski got 2nd place in group C by losing to OpTic Gaming and defeating LGD.Forever Young twice. Overall, Mineski is sitting at number 5 in the Dota Pro Circuit rankings table with 3150 points. That alone should make them clear favorites to win this match. However, based on what we’ve seen so far from paiN Gaming and given the disproportionate odds, you should definitely consider rooting for the underdog in this match.
Match prediction: paiN Gaming to win given a +1.5 maps advantage.
OG vs. Fnatic
OG started to show signs of recovery at the previous tournament, MDL Changsha Major, where it got 3rd place in group A by defeating teams like Mineski. At ESL One Birmingham 2018, OG won group B with victories over paiN Gaming and Vici Gaming. And even though it failed to qualify directly for the Semifinals by losing against both Virtus.pro and OpTic Gaming in the first place decider matches, OG is still much stronger than most people anticipated before the event.
Fnatic has everything to play for in this match which it will very likely win, considering its great recent form and its formidable roster. The Southeast Asian team is currently sitting at number 12 within the Dota Pro Circuit rankings with 1040 points.
At ESL One Birmingham 2018, Fnatic finished 2nd in a difficult group A, defeating Evil Geniuses and Team Spirit but losing against Virtus.pro.
This may turn out to be a very close match, although the odds clearly indicate that everyone expects Fnatic to win. No doubt, Abed and his teammates have a high chance of doing that but they will most likely need 3 games to get the job done. A 2 – 0 result in their favor seems quite improbable.
Match prediction: Fnatic to win
